In accordance with the provisions of N.J.S.A. 39:4-197, the following off-street municipal parking yards and Board of Education property as shown in Schedule XXIII (§ 168-78) attached to and made part of this chapter are designated as handicapped parking areas. Such spaces are for use by persons who have been issued special identification cards, plates or placards by the Division of Motor Vehicles or a temporary placard issued by the Chief of Police in accordance with N.J.S.A. 39:4-205 and 39:4-206. No other person shall be permitted to park a vehicle in these spaces.

In accordance with the provisions of N.J.S.A. 39:4-197, the following on-street locations as shown in Schedule XXIV (§ 168-79) attached to and made part of this chapter are designed as handicapped parking spaces. Such spaces are for use by persons who have been issued special identification cards or plates or placards by the Division of Motor Vehicles or a temporary placard issued by the Chief of Police. No other person shall be permitted to park in these spaces.
In accordance with the provisions of N.J.S.A. 40:48-2.46, the following off-street parking yards as shown in Schedule XXV (§ 168-80) attached to and made a part of this chapter are designated as handicapped parking areas. Such spaces are for use by persons who have been issued special identification cards, plates or placards by the Division of Motor Vehicles or a temporary placard issued by the Chief of Police in accordance with N.J.S.A. 39:4-205 and 39:4-206. No other person shall be permitted to park a vehicle in these spaces.
In accordance with the provisions of N.J.S.A. 39:5A-1, the following off-street parking yards as shown in Schedule XXVI (§ 168-81) attached to and made part of this chapter are designated as handicapped parking areas. Such spaces are for use by persons who have been issued special identification cards, plates or placards by the Division of Motor Vehicles or a temporary placard issued by the Chief of Police in accordance with N.J.S.A. 39:4-205 and 39:4-206. No other person shall be permitted to park a vehicle in these areas.

A. 
The owners of the premises referred to in §§ 168-32 and 168-33 shall provide and install signs and pavement markings for each parking space reserved for use by handicapped persons, which signing and markings shall be in accordance with the Manual of Uniform Traffic Control Devices, N.J.S.A. 39:4-198 and the Americans with Disabilities Act of 1990. The cost of procurement and installation of the signs and pavement markings shall be the responsibility of the owner of said property. The owner shall, subsequent to initial procurement and installation, maintain such signs and pavement markings in good condition at no cost or expense to the Township. The owner shall be responsible for the repair and restoration or replacement of the same.
B. 
The Township and the Board of Education, respectively, shall provide and install signs for the premises referred to in § 168-30 and signs and pavement markings for each parking space reserved for use by handicapped persons, which signing and markings shall be in accordance with the Manual of Uniform Traffic Devices, N.J.S.A. 39:4-198 and the Americans with Disabilities Act of 1990. The cost of procurement and installation of the signs and pavement markings shall be the responsibility of the Township and the Board of Education, respectively. The Board of Education shall, subsequent to initial procurement and installation, maintain such signs and pavement markings in good condition at no cost or expense to the Township. The Township and the Board of Education, respectively, shall be responsible for the repair and restoration or replacement of the same. All signs and pavement markings shall be in accordance with the requirements of the Americans with Disabilities Act of 1990.
C. 
At each designated handicapped parking space there shall be installed a handicapped sign, which may be wall or post mounted or in the ground. View of the sign shall not be obstructed when a vehicle is parking in the space. Van accessible parking spaces shall have an additional sign mounted below the handicapped sign, stating "van accessible."
